Trion 7000

Dual-element Ribbon Microphone Thick and rich, the dual ribbon "rounds out" guitar stacks, brass, and woodwinds. A narrow strip of ultra thin aluminum suspended in a magnetic field oscillates symbiotically with your sound source. Electrical current is the result. We use two ribbons for added sensitivity. Experience classic ribbon vocal sound.

The polar pattern of the Trion 7000 is naturally a figure-8. This means that the microphone is most sensitive in the front and the back, and least sensitive at the sides. The pronounced proximity effect associated with the Trion 7000 means that a strong “fattening effect” can be achieved at close distances. The rugged metal housing and construction provide durability. Shock mount, heavy-duty aluminum carrying case included.

As with any passive ribbon microphone, ensure that the Trion 7000 is NOT plugged into active phantom power. Phantom power can permanently damage the delicate ribbon. The Trion 7000 should not be used in a kick drum where the strong air blasts might permanently stretch the ribbon. Due to the strong magnetic fields inside a ribbon microphone, areas where ferrous dust and filings are present should be avoided. A pop-filter is recommended for close vocal use.

Applications

Studio Vocals, Voice-over, Acoustic Instrument, Brass, Guitar Cabinets, Strings, Piano.

Specifications

  • Operating Principle: Moving ribbon dynamic
  • Polar Pattern: Figure-of-eight
  • Frequency Response: 25 Hz – 9 kHz
  • Sensitivity: -53dBV (2.2mV) @ 1Pa
  • Impedance: 940 ohms

D189

This is a rugged dynamic microphone that delivers exceptional sound quality in a variety of live sound applications. The mic's proprietary Flex-Form hardened steel grille screen withstands deformation caused by on-stage abuse. CAD's (I.N.R2) impact Noise Reduction system optimizes performance in live settings. A durable “soft-feel” coating provides extra protection and ensures greater reliability. The D189 is ideal for those who want exceptional sonic performance and durability in a live microphone. Mic clip and 15' XLRM to XLRF microphone cable included.

Applications

Live Vocals, Guitar Cabinets, Bass Cabinets, Snare Drum.

Specifications

  • Operating Principle: Moving Coil Dynamic
  • Polar Pattern: Supercardioid 
  • Frequency Response: 40Hz to 18kHz
  • Sensitivity: -54dBV (2.0mV) @ 1 Pa
  • Impedance: 200 ohms
